Charmi's
latest
is
a
heroine-oriented
role
in
16
Days,
a
film
directed
by
Prabhu
Solomon
and
produced
by
P
Mahesh
Babu
and
D.
Nageswara
Rao
under
Cosmos
Entertainment
banner.
Aravind,
who
was
Mani
Ratnam's
co-director,
is
debuting
as
hero.
A
song
was
filmed
recently
for
the
movie
at
Annapurna
Seven
Acres
Studio,
Hyderabad.
The
director
said,
"The
film
revolves
around
an
incident
that
took
place
within
16
days,
hence
the
title
16
Days
was
chosen.
Bhaskarabhatla
wrote
the
lyrics
and
Dharan
set
them
to
music.
Chinni
Prakash
choreographed
the
song."
Charmi
said,
"The
shooting
will
be
wrapped
up
with
this
song.
my
role
is
that
of
an
angel,
something
I
have
never
done
before;
I
expect
this
to
be
one
of
my
best
roles.
The
hero
and
heroine
fall
in
love
within
16
days
and
something
unexpected
happens
on
the
last
day."
Chinni
Prakash
said,
"I
have
choreographed
a
song
in
Telugu
after
a
long
gap.
Charmi's
a
natural
dancer
and
was
very
comfortable
doing
some
difficult
footwork."
The
lyricist
said,
"The
songs
are
all
quite
unique
in
keeping
with
this
thrilling
subject."
Manorama,
Kota
Srinivasa
Rao,
Jayaprakash
Reddy,
Dharmavarapu
Subrahmanyam
and
Ramjagan
are
the
supporting
cast.
Sukumar
is
the
cinematographer;
story,
screenplay
and
direction
are
by
Prabhu
Solomon.
